Onion Jam
Onion Jam is the jam! Caramelized onions, sweet prunes, and spices reduce down into a heavenly condiment. This recipe goes well for burgers, steak, pork, on crackers or even toast for breakfast!

📝 Preparation Steps
1
Warm
2
In a medium-sized saucepan, warm oil over medium heat; add in the onions, thyme, salt, and pepper. Cook until onions are soft and translucent, stirring frequently, about ⏱️ 10 minutes.
3
Add broth, sugar, honey, vinegar, ginger, and prunes to the pot; continue cooking, stirring frequently, until onions begin to caramelize and prunes break down, about 10-15 more minutes.
honey2 tbsp
4
Stir
5
While cooking, continue to stir to prevent scorching. If the mixture seems to be a bit dry, add a small splash of water toward the end. Do not overcook! Onions should be caramelized, and there should still be a little bit of juice in the pot when it’s ready.
6
Cool
7
Let jam cool, then transfer to a lidded jar and store in the refrigerator.
